A Postgraduate Certificate in Nanoscale Metrology Techniques equips students with advanced knowledge and practical skills in characterizing and measuring nanoscale structures and materials. The program focuses on developing expertise in cutting-edge metrology techniques crucial for various nanotechnology applications.
Learning outcomes typically include a comprehensive understanding of fundamental nanoscale metrology principles, proficiency in operating advanced instrumentation like atomic force microscopy (AFM) and scanning electron microscopy (SEM), and the ability to analyze and interpret complex datasets obtained from nanoscale measurements. Students will gain experience in data analysis software and develop strong problem-solving skills applicable to real-world nanoscale challenges.
The duration of a Postgraduate Certificate in Nanoscale Metrology Techniques varies depending on the institution but generally ranges from several months to a year of part-time or full-time study. The program structure often incorporates a blend of theoretical lectures, laboratory sessions, and potentially a research project focusing on a specific area within nanoscale metrology, such as dimensional metrology or material characterization.
